Transaction 34de953cdc8a7f4c88214e4d8cc8779219b3cb2808763ff0da29d668de58e1f8
1 Input
1 Output
-
34de953cdc8a7f4c88214e4d8cc8779219b3cb2808763ff0da29d668de58e1f8:0
- value
- 93888
- script pubkey
- OP_0 OP_PUSHBYTES_20 8ee580bfb8db9c2b3632d94b2c5b74be7e08b232
- address
- bc1q3mjcp0acmwwzkd3jm99jckm5helq3v3ju5mlew